By destroying the head, the resurrector mech serum can be used to heal brain injuries. Extracting the [[skull]]{{IdeologyIcon}} will destroy the head safely and consistently. Without the [[Ideology DLC]], you can eat the corpse. However, this is inconsistent and risks them consuming the corpse entirely.
